Transaction 87106b2ce799718160fdd3f70890da3975fb12c34f792cd556ca3f4f018eb76d
3 Input
2 Outputs
- 87106b2ce799718160fdd3f70890da3975fb12c34f792cd556ca3f4f018eb76d:0
- 87106b2ce799718160fdd3f70890da3975fb12c34f792cd556ca3f4f018eb76d:1
value 450000000000
address moMCcdqHiEfEUiYzgVS5p6cWX4un5qqwAv
value 250000000000
address mikkBigQiw2kStSFN5zXcGPeZMJVfmvtCW